Great place to stay, cleanliness probably it's strong point along with helpful, friendly staff and a great atmosphere amongst a large city. A bit of a commute if you were expecting to be right in the centre, but for those who prefer to be slightly away from the hustle and bustle of the main square, this will suit you well.
